If the last two years have been any indication, no industry is safe from the Great Resignation. The latest PwC Pulse Survey found that 77% of respondents said hiring and retaining employees is their most critical growth driver this year. As we have previously covered, many employees see the current job market as the perfect opportunity to find a position that allows them to move beyond their least favorite job duties. Furthermore, if the employee responsible for compliance leaves your organization without properly onboarding new staff, the knowledge of custom processes can leave with them. Utilizing automation in your compliance process can ensure that employee churn doesn’t affect your sales tax compliance.
